Queue all slurmctld message traffic rather than immediately spawning pthreads
(which exhaust available memory). Restructure slurmctld agent logic for higher throughput.
Showing
- NEWS 4 additions, 0 deletionsNEWS
- src/slurmctld/agent.c 62 additions, 12 deletionssrc/slurmctld/agent.c
- src/slurmctld/agent.h 12 additions, 5 deletionssrc/slurmctld/agent.h
- src/slurmctld/controller.c 2 additions, 6 deletionssrc/slurmctld/controller.c
- src/slurmctld/job_mgr.c 5 additions, 38 deletionssrc/slurmctld/job_mgr.c
- src/slurmctld/job_scheduler.c 1 addition, 20 deletionssrc/slurmctld/job_scheduler.c
- src/slurmctld/node_scheduler.c 4 additions, 40 deletionssrc/slurmctld/node_scheduler.c
- src/slurmctld/step_mgr.c 1 addition, 16 deletionssrc/slurmctld/step_mgr.c
Loading
Please register or sign in to comment